On Thu, Apr 04, 2019 at 12:04:14AM +0800, Wen Yang wrote:
> The call to of_get_parent returns a node pointer with refcount
> incremented thus it must be explicitly decremented after the last
> usage.
>
> Detected by coccinelle with the following warnings:
> drivers/gpu/drm/rcar-du/rcar_du_of.c:235:2-8: ERROR: missing of_node_put; acquired a node pointer with refcount incremented on line 216, but without a corresponding object release within this function.
> drivers/gpu/drm/rcar-du/rcar_du_of.c:236:2-8: ERROR: missing of_node_put; acquired a node pointer with refcount incremented on line 209, but without a corresponding object release within this function.
